Research on Multi-objective Decision Model based on Location-allocation Analysis during Emergency Traffic Evacuation

Large-scale emergency events bring a lot of effect to peoples ordinary life, so it is necessary to provide fast and effective location-allocation analysis information for emergency traffic evacuation and succor. In this issue, some related models based on location-allocation analysis are introduced into emergency traffic evacuation field. Considering the actual situation and character of emergency traffic evacuation, we develop maximum covering models which are applied to emergency traffic evacuation and its optimized algorithm. Finally, we discuss some feasible solution strategies, and then get the large-scale emergency traffic evacuation plant provide dependable decision-making support for succor.
